calcul de cq - Multimédia - Linux et OS Alternatifs
Marsh Posté le 13-06-2007 à 16:30:04
Pouvez répéter la questiooooooooon ?
Plus sérieusement, tu peux essayer de formater un peu ton post, parce que là bon, j'ai un peu de mal ... (et pourtant je dois avoir la réponse à au moins une partie )
Marsh Posté le 13-06-2007 à 16:43:01
Marsh Posté le 13-06-2007 à 16:44:42
c'est quoi le cq?
Marsh Posté le 13-06-2007 à 17:10:34
wedgeant a écrit : |
C'est du bash tout basic...;-((
cat duree.txt c'est le contenu d'un petit fichier texte qui contient la durée en s du film...
J'ai un doute car mon script sur un film de 2h12 me dit celacopié collé de la console)
CALCULETTE de bitrate et de cq :
============================================================
support:700 meg; video:610 kbits/s; coefficient de qualité:0.2001; résolution:544:224
support:700 meg; video:610 kbits/s; coefficient de qualité:0.2062; résolution:528:224
support:700 meg; video:610 kbits/s; coefficient de qualité:0.2290; résolution:512:208
support:750 meg; video:662 kbits/s; coefficient de qualité:0.2174; résolution:544:224
support:750 meg; video:662 kbits/s; coefficient de qualité:0.2240; résolution:528:224
support:750 meg; video:662 kbits/s; coefficient de qualité:0.2488; résolution:512:208
support:800 meg; video:715 kbits/s; coefficient de qualité:0.2013; résolution:592:240
support:800 meg; video:715 kbits/s; coefficient de qualité:0.2069; résolution:576:240
support:800 meg; video:715 kbits/s; coefficient de qualité:0.2128; résolution:560:240
support:800 meg; video:715 kbits/s; coefficient de qualité:0.2347; résolution:544:224
support:800 meg; video:715 kbits/s; coefficient de qualité:0.2418; résolution:528:224
support:800 meg; video:715 kbits/s; coefficient de qualité:0.2686; résolution:512:208
support:850 meg; video:768 kbits/s; coefficient de qualité:0.2161; résolution:592:240
support:850 meg; video:768 kbits/s; coefficient de qualité:0.2221; résolution:576:240
support:850 meg; video:768 kbits/s; coefficient de qualité:0.2285; résolution:560:240
support:850 meg; video:768 kbits/s; coefficient de qualité:0.2520; résolution:544:224
support:850 meg; video:768 kbits/s; coefficient de qualité:0.2596; résolution:528:224
support:850 meg; video:768 kbits/s; coefficient de qualité:0.2884; résolution:512:208
=============================================================
Ce qui me laisse pensif c'est que les vbitrates calculés sont bien bas pour des cq élevés pourtant je suis les formules du site mplayer.
En fait j'ai fait un script qui me prend un dvd pour l'encoder en divx (ou un mpeg de la tnt)me fait le croppage propose plusieurs résolutions avec le bitrate etc.
Bref un tuxrip sauf que c'est adapté pour ma kiss dp1000.
PS: le cq est le coeff de qualité des encodages.
Marsh Posté le 14-06-2007 à 00:46:44
prof27 a écrit : En fait j'ai fait un script qui me prend un dvd pour l'encoder en divx (ou un mpeg de la tnt)me fait le croppage propose plusieurs résolutions avec le bitrate etc. |
Tu connais ripdvd ?
Je pense que ça devrait répondre à tes besoins. Sinon, inutile de tout écrire from scratch : rejoins l'équipe de développement et propose les fonctionnalités qui te manquent. Je ne crois pas m'avancer beaucoup en disant que Wedge t'accueillera à bras ouverts si tu as des idées de features manquantes dans ripdvd.
Marsh Posté le 14-06-2007 à 00:51:22
Pour autant que je puisse en juger, ton bitrate est bon. Par contre, je ne sais pas exactement ce qu'est le CQ, donc je ne peux pas te dire si ça me semble correct...
Marsh Posté le 14-06-2007 à 06:47:29
franceso a écrit : |
Bonjour.
C'est marrant de faire son propre truc même si je pense qu'il n'y a pas 360000 façons de faire.
J'utilise que 1 MByte=1024 Kbytes=1024*1024*8 bits et 1kbits = 1000 bits c'est cela je me gourre pas dans cette convention?
Merci pour ripdvd .
Je connaissais déja dpencoder tuxrip acidrip dvd::rip gmencoder kvideoencoder... :-))))))
Marsh Posté le 14-06-2007 à 08:18:41
Y'a un topic officiel pour ripdvd
Tu pourras regarder la fonction calc_video_bitrate() dans le fichier lib/config.rdl, tu trouveras la réponse à ta question
Marsh Posté le 14-06-2007 à 09:20:40
prof27 a écrit : J'utilise que 1 MByte=1024 Kbytes=1024*1024*8 bits et 1kbits = 1000 bits c'est cela je me gourre pas dans cette convention? |
Oui, a priori ce calcul là est bon. Maintenant, reste à voir la définition du CQ. D'après ta formule, ce serait le nombre moyen de bits par pixel... C'est ça ?
Marsh Posté le 14-06-2007 à 12:30:32
franceso a écrit : Oui, a priori ce calcul là est bon. Maintenant, reste à voir la définition du CQ. D'après ta formule, ce serait le nombre moyen de bits par pixel... C'est ça ? |
Oui.
Marsh Posté le 14-06-2007 à 12:37:55
prof27 a écrit : Oui. |
Je viens d'encoder un film en deux passes et le calcul de bitrate marche pile-poil avec mencoder car
si je choisis l'option suivante dans le tableau(cq énorme):
"support:1400 meg; video:1348 kbits/s; coefficient de qualité:0.3463; résolution:608:256"
Au final j'ai bien un avi de 1,4 Gig et mencoder me met à la fin:
Video stream: 1348.067 kbit/s (168508 B/s) size: 1341131567 bytes 7958.840 secs
Audio stream: 128.000 kbit/s (15999 B/s) size: 127342464 bytes 7958.904 secs
C'est impec.
Mais le cq que je calcule est très grand
Marsh Posté le 14-06-2007 à 12:53:56
Et du coup, c'est quoi le CQ ?
Marsh Posté le 14-06-2007 à 12:56:59
wedgeant a écrit : Y'a un topic officiel pour ripdvd |
Le bitrate pose pas de probleme c'est le cq
je viens d'ouvrir cet avi avec avidemux et bien dans sa calculettte de cq il voit le meme cq>0,3 pour une taille de 2 cd mais pour un cd un cq de 0.152.
Marsh Posté le 13-06-2007 à 16:28:06
Bonjour.
Je me suis fait ma calculette de cq pour encoder mes dvd ou les film de la tnt .
J'ai des doutes sur mes formules.
Je calcule le vbitrate en encodant mes film en audio CBR 128 kbits/s:
$j est dans 700 ; 750 ; 800 ; 850 MO etc.
vbrvid=$(echo "scale=2;($j*8*1024*1024/1000/`cat duree.txt`)-128"| bc -l)
Puis le cq proprement dit:
cq=$(echo "scale=4;$vbrvid*1000/(25*$w*$l)"| bc -l)
Pour du pal donc 25 fps et wxl étant els pixels de chaque frame.
Est-ce correct?
Merci.